Vin Diesel identifies as a person of color and has a mixed ethnic background, primarily stemming from his mother's European ancestry and his biological father's background.
His racial and ethnic identity is multifaceted, reflecting a diverse heritage:
- Maternal Ancestry: His mother is white, with a blend of European descents including English, German, Scottish, and Irish roots.
- Paternal Ancestry: While details about his biological father are less public, Vin Diesel himself has stated that he is "definitely a person of colour" when referring to his biological father's background.
- Adoptive Family Influence: He was raised by his adoptive African-American father, which further contributed to his upbringing and cultural experience.
